In Fort Cobb, Oklahoma, where the population is under 3,000, access to mental health care can be challenging. Virtual Intensive Outpatient Programs (IOP) bridge this gap by providing essential mental health support right from home. These programs are tailored for individuals struggling with various mental health issues and substance use disorders, allowing for flexibility that suits the lifestyles of local residents.
The benefits of Virtual IOP for those in Fort Cobb are plentiful. With structured therapy sessions ranging from 9 to 20 hours per week, participants can engage in evidence-based treatments such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T). This allows individuals to maintain their work, school, and family commitments while receiving the support they need to thrive.
Starting your journey with a Virtual IOP is simple. Programs typically offer a combination of individual therapy, group sessions, and family involvement, all conducted through HIPAA-compliant video conferencing.
